DescriptionAbout Reserv

Reserv is an insurtech creating and incubating cutting-edge AI and automation technology to bring efficiency and simplicity to claims. Founded by insurtech veterans with deep experience in SaaS and digital claims, Reserv is venture-backed by Bain Capital and Altai Ventures and began operations in May 2022. We are focused on automating highly manual tasks to tackle long-standing problems in claims and set a new standard for TPAs, insurance technology providers, and adjusters alike.

Requirements
  • Minimum of 5 years of commercial total loss experience on point and concentrated in transportation claims adjusting, ideally with:
    • Total Loss adjusting experience
    • First-party Comp and Collision
    • Third-party Property Damage Liability
    • Experience with Ride Share (or TNC/Livery) is required.
  • 2+ years of leadership experience with a preference for experience managing in a remote environment
  • Comfortable with technology and the ability to evolve the claims systems and processes to drive better efficiencies and outcomes
  • Demonstrated commitment to quality, accuracy, and attention to detail
  • Integrity, ethics, and a strong sense of accountability in handling confidential and sensitive information
  • Bachelor's degree (lack of one should not stop you from applying if you possess all the other qualifications)
  • Active adjuster license required: resident state license if available, otherwise a Designated Home State (DHS) license
